Analysis
Corsica (region, level 2) recorded 3.17 Percentage change for exposure to drought β land soil moisture anomaly in 2024.
Compared with earlier readings it is up 777.7% on the previous year and up 35.6% over ten years.
Over the whole period, exposure to drought β land soil moisture anomaly in Corsica (region, level 2) peaked at 12.22 Percentage change in 2018 and was at its lowest, -13.41 Percentage change, in 2017.
Corsica (region, level 2) ranks 46th of 234 countries on this measure, in the top quarter.
The series is highly variable year to year, so single readings are best treated with caution.

About this data
The dataset provides annual anomalies in land and cropland soil moisture content of the top soil layer compared to the reference period 1981-2010. Exposure indicators to drought have been prepared by the Organisation for Economic Co-operation and Development (OECD). Please see the working paper for a more complete description of the methods. The datasets span the period 1981-2022 and is the result of the use of a variety of geospatial data sources, including the ERA5-Land averaged monthly data of volumetric soil moisture and ESA CCI land cover data. Average anomalies have been calculated for both land and cropland exposure to drought. The dataset has a global coverage on a national level; on the sub-national TL2 level (i.e. large subnational regions) results are reported for all OECD countries as well as for Argentina, Brazil, China, India, Indonesia and South Africa. A number of aggregates are included: Euro area, European Union, Advanced economies, Emerging market economies, G7, G20, OECD, OECD Europe, OECD Asia Oceania, OECD Americas and the LAC region.
